Forms of ownership
Advantage of merger&Acquisition
increase revenue by cross-selling products to each other's customers
increase market share by combing product line
increase their buying powet
new expertise,system & teams of employees
Disadvantage of merger and acquisition
executives have to agree on how the merger will be financed
managers need to decide who will be in charge after join forces
marketing departments need to figure out how to blend product lines,branding strategies & adverttisement
lay-off

Merger
an action taken by 2 companies to combine & perform as single entity
Types of merger
vertical merger
horizontal merger
Acquisition
an action taken by 1 company to buy a controlling interest in the voting stock of another company
Hostile takeover(against wish of the management)
strategic alliance & joint venture
strategic alliance :long-term artnership between companies to jointly develop,produce products
joint venture :a separate legal entity established by 2 or more companies to pursue shared business objectives
